B. Complete the text by translating the words in brackets into English:
We are surrounded by technology. I don’t even have to leave my house to ind tens of
examples. I use my (1) c _ _ _ _ _ _ _ (komputer) almost every day, I listen to my MP3
(2) p _ _ _ _ _ (odtwarzacz) when I tidy my room or make breakfast for myself. Talking about
tidying, a (3) h _ _ _ _ _ (odkurzacz) is another (4) i _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 (wynalazek) I use.
We have a (5) s _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 (telewizja satelitarna) and a (6) p _ _ _ _ _ s _ _ _ _ _
(ekran plazmowy) in our living room, a (7) m _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 (kuchenka mikrofalowa) and
a (8) d _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 (zmywarka) in our kitchen, each of us have their own
(9) m _ _ _ _ _ p _ _ _ _ (telefon komórkowy). We also have a (10) w _ _ _ _ _ _ m _ _ _ _ _ _
(pralka) in the bathroom. Technology is just everywhere.
C. Cross the odd one out:
1. experiment – research – test – scanner
2. physics – physical education – chemistry – archeology
3. reaction – element – cursor – molecule
4. plane – spacecraft – planet – universe
5. delete – print – discover – save
6. solid – gadget – gas – liquid

Suggested follow-up:
Put the students into pairs (A and B). Student A
claims that we can live without technology,
student B claims that life without technology is
impossible. Then they swap roles.
